The 2025 CIMS Users Meeting was held in York, UK this year. The four day event was held in the historic Guildhall. A truly unique location, the Guildhall was built in the 1400s, but has been updated to host current events. The city of York has a grand history and includes remnants from the Roman, Viking and Medieval periods. There was much to explore during the attendees’ free time.
This year’s meeting was truly successful. We had the second-highest ever in-person attendance with lots of talks, tutorials, and updates. Most importantly, our users from all over the world shared their knowledge, including many remote talks and discussions. Thank you to everyone who participated!
